Output 66f0a58f7572021c8a02e620d51b76da27a4c686508a8306f9ebadab07db5758:1

value
22904664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c82bf059334867079b85e9057a87b93470e060c0 OP_EQUAL
address
3KwRhqQdbuoxnsUcpYtwkGRVwUwjEq46r9
transaction
66f0a58f7572021c8a02e620d51b76da27a4c686508a8306f9ebadab07db5758
spent
true